Key Features of the Midea Cube 20-Pint Dehumidifier

Compact Design

The Midea Cube 20-Pint Dehumidifier stands out with its stackable design, making it easy to store and perfect for small spaces. Its innovative design reduces storage hassles, making it a convenient choice for apartments, dorms, and smaller rooms.

High Dehumidification Capacity

Despite its small size, the unit removes up to 20 pints of moisture daily, effectively reducing humidity levels and preventing mold and mildew growth in confined spaces.

Energy Efficiency

Equipped with Energy Star certification, the Midea Cube 20-Pint Dehumidifier ensures optimal energy use, making it an energy-efficient dehumidifier that saves on electricity bills while maintaining performance.

Smart Features

The dehumidifier features Wi-Fi connectivity, allowing users to control and monitor it via a smartphone app. It also integrates seamlessly with voice assistants like Alexa and Google Assistant for convenience.

Large Water Tank

This model boasts a water tank with a larger-than-expected capacity, reducing the frequency of emptying and supporting continuous drainage options for uninterrupted operation.


Technical Specifications and Features

Specification
Details
Moisture Removal
Up to 20 pints per day
Water Tank Capacity
3 liters
Energy Certification
Energy Star certified
Connectivity
Wi-Fi enabled; app and voice assistant control
Dimensions
12.3 x 12.3 x 12.4 inches
Weight
23.8 pounds
Noise Level
50 dB (whisper-quiet operation)

Cleaning and Maintenance Instructions

Cleaning the Water Tank

Regular water tank cleaning is essential to prevent mold and bacteria buildup. Use warm, soapy water and a soft cloth to clean the tank weekly.

Filter Maintenance

The washable filter requires periodic cleaning. Rinse the filter under running water every month and ensure it is completely dry before reinstalling.

Descaling

For areas with hard water, descale the dehumidifier every few months using a vinegar-water solution to maintain optimal performance.

General Tips

  • Always unplug the unit before cleaning.
  • Check for blockages in the drainage hose if continuous drainage is used.
  • Inspect the unit periodically for any signs of wear or damage.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

Unit Not Turning On

Ensure the unit is plugged in and the water tank is correctly positioned. Check for blown fuses or tripped breakers if the problem persists.

Poor Dehumidification Performance

Clean the filter and ensure the air intake is unobstructed. Verify that doors and windows are closed to contain humidity control.

Water Tank Not Draining

Check for blockages in the drainage hose and ensure it is securely attached. For manual emptying, inspect the tank for cracks or leaks.


Storage and Seasonal Use Tips

  • Pre-Storage Maintenance: Clean the water tank and filter thoroughly before storing the unit.
  • Storage Location: Store the dehumidifier in a dry, cool place to prevent damage.
  • Seasonal Setup: Inspect the unit for dust or debris before reuse and test its operation.
